🛂 Documents & Security

  • Valid passport + any visa
  • Copies of passport/visa
  • Driver’s license
  • Travel insurance card + contact info
  • Credit + debit card
  • Small amount of cash
  • Emergency contact card
  • Printed flight tickets
  • RFID wallet or neck pouch
  • TSA/cable lock
